Since 2013, China is the third largest foreign investor in the world and Europe is a major destination for Chinese investing firms, especially the largest European economies where the great majority of their investments are concentrated. In this chapter, we provide a comprehensive map of Chinese Foreign Direct Investments (FDI) in Europe, taking into account their distribution by country, sector, entry-mode and business activity. The empirical analysis relies on firm-level data compiled from diverse data sources on greenfield investments and Merger & Acquisitions (M&As). We show that Chinese FDI in Europe are very concentrated in a few host countries and in a few sectors, namely automotive, communications, electronics, machinery and engines.
